  1. Network will not show one PC


    Network error

    Windows 10 Version 2004

    One PC can not be seen on the network.

    Net View shows “The network location can not be reached.”

    SMB 1.0/CIFS File Sharing Support has been added to Windows 10

    Anti-Virus program suspended to rule it out.



    Now Net View continually responds with error 64 “Network name no longer available.”

  2. Laptop won't show list of available networks

    We suggest checking the list of available Wi-Fi networks on your laptop.

    Please follow these steps:

    • Click the Windows logo.
    • Go to Settings (gear icon).
    • Select Network and Internet.
    • Then Wi-Fi.
    • Make sure the Wi-Fi radio button is On.
    • Select Show available networks, then you'll be able to see the list of available Wi-Fi networks.
